If yes, you should use the following one: >>> >>> http://svn.pardus.org.tr/uludag/trunk/kde4/pardusman/ >>> > > So PardusMan for repos pardus-2008.2 ad pardus-2009 differs right? > > if i am using pardus-2009 repo for pardusman image creation, i have to > use http://svn.pardus.org.tr/uludag/trunk/kde4/pardusman/ right ? > Actually what differs is the GUI toolkit used. Pardus 2009 won't contain KDE3 and Qt3 so pardusman is re-written for KDE4 with PyQt4. The python in Pardus 2009 repository is 2.6 and the os module needs /dev/urandom for correctly working. I think that's why you're having this exception during image creation out of the 2009 repository. The stable repo holds all the different versions of the same software, it's kind of useless to mirror via rsync. I had urged the system administrators at the time to create a seperate rsync repo which includes only the latest versions of the software for rsync mirroring but to no avail. I had written a script here that uses wget to mirror only the latest versions of a repo. It's not great, could be more optimized but it does the work nevertheless. http://zzz.fisek.com.tr/files/pardus-local-repo.sh Hope it helps. Then we decided to fork off a devel/ subdirectory for each of our version leading to the following hierarchy: pardus/ 2008/ devel/ stable/ 2009/ devel/ stable/ devel/ * contrib/ 2008/ devel/ stable/ devel/ ** So the one marked with * is obsoleted, all development for Pardus 2008 repository is done in pardus/2008/devel. Then you request a merge by sending an e-mail to the stable@ mailing list. The other one marked with ** will be obsoleted when 2009/ is created under contrib. So all development for Contrib 2008 repository is done in contrib/2008/devel and then you merge your changes directly to contrib/2008/stable *without* requesting a merge through the stable@ mailing list. contrib/devel can now be considered the devel/ for the upcoming contrib/2009 repository. But since the 2009/ directory is still not created for contrib, the ** directory should be used for maintenance of contrib packages for 2009.
